Home
last modified time | relevance | path

Searched refs:LDSKernelId (Results 1 – 6 of 6)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/
H A DAMDGPUArgumentUsageInfo.cpp77 << " LDSKernelId: " << FI.second.LDSKernelId in print()
111 return std::tuple(LDSKernelId ? &LDSKernelId : nullptr, in getPreloadedValue()
170 AI.LDSKernelId = ArgDescriptor::createRegister(AMDGPU::SGPR15); in fixedABILayout()
H A DSIMachineFunctionInfo.cpp41 WorkGroupIDZ(false), WorkGroupInfo(false), LDSKernelId(false), in SIMachineFunctionInfo()
141 LDSKernelId = true; in SIMachineFunctionInfo()
255 ArgInfo.LDSKernelId = ArgDescriptor::createRegister(getNextUserSGPR()); in addLDSKernelId()
257 return ArgInfo.LDSKernelId.getRegister(); in addLDSKernelId()
683 Any |= convertArg(AI.LDSKernelId, ArgInfo.LDSKernelId); in convertArgumentInfo()
H A DAMDGPUArgumentUsageInfo.h141 ArgDescriptor LDSKernelId; member
H A DSIMachineFunctionInfo.h178 std::optional<SIArgument> LDSKernelId;
203 YamlIO.mapOptional("LDSKernelId", AI.LDSKernelId);
489 bool LDSKernelId : 1;
886 bool hasLDSKernelId() const { return LDSKernelId; }
H A DAMDGPUTargetMachine.cpp1935 parseAndCheckArgument(YamlMFI.ArgInfo->LDSKernelId, in parseMachineFunctionInfo()
1937 MFI->ArgInfo.LDSKernelId, 0, 1) || in parseMachineFunctionInfo()
H A DSIISelLowering.cpp2532 allocateSGPR32Input(CCInfo, ArgInfo.LDSKernelId); in allocateSpecialInputSGPRs()